For your dad who loves volunteering at local charities and nonprofits, there are many meaningful gift ideas that will celebrate his passion for giving back. Here are a few personalized and thoughtful options to consider:
1. Donation in His Name: Make a donation to one of the charities or nonprofits he supports. Choose a cause he is passionate about, and let him know that a contribution has been made in his name. This not only shows your support for his dedication but also amplifies his impact in the community.
2. Volunteer Experience: Research opportunities for your dad to volunteer his time or skills in a unique way. Look for special programs like Habitat for Humanity's Global Village, where he can join volunteer projects abroad. Alternatively, find volunteering opportunities that align with his specific interests, such as working with children, elderly care, or environmental initiatives.
3. Personalized Volunteer Gear: Get him a personalized volunteer t-shirt, hat, or hoodie with his name or a logo of his favorite charity. This will make him feel proud and showcase his commitment when he is out helping others. Additionally, you can consider customizing a volunteer-themed tote bag or water bottle for him to use during his volunteer activities.
4. Inspiring Books: Look for books on inspiring stories of philanthropy, social change, or memoirs of notable volunteers. Some popular titles include "Giving: How Each of Us Can Change the World" by Bill Clinton, "The Life You Can Save" by Peter Singer, or "Mountains Beyond Mountains" by Tracy Kidder. These books will inspire and motivate your dad to continue making a difference.
5. Photography or Scrapbooking: If your dad enjoys capturing memories, encourage him to create a volunteer photo album or a scrapbook featuring his time with different organizations. Provide him with a high-quality photo album, scrapbook materials, and a disposable camera when he volunteers. This will allow him to capture memorable moments and reflect on the positive impact he has made.
6. Supportive Merchandise: Many charities and nonprofits offer merchandise that supports their cause. Consider purchasing items like wristbands, keychains, or pins that promote a cause he cares about. Not only will these items create a sense of camaraderie among volunteers but also serve as a daily reminder of his dedication.
7. Commemorative Plaque: Find a local engraving or printing service to create a customized plaque recognizing your dad's commitment to volunteering. Include his name, years of service, and a heartfelt message. He can proudly display this plaque in his office or at home as a symbol of his dedication to giving back.
Remember, the intention behind the gift is what matters most. By choosing a gift that aligns with his passion for volunteering, you will not only show your love and appreciation but also reinforce his commitment to making a positive impact in the community.
